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it Gets Demo, Release Date

Korean horror title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it released a demo for its prologue today on Steam. Players take control of a Korean girl as she seeks vengeance against her murderers and family’s killers.

Making a deal with Jeoseung Saja, a God of Death, her restless spirit returns to the material world. Now able to possess mortals, she plots her revenge. She can quickly switch bodies to stealthily approach, or use their abilities and weapons instead. The full release of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it is June 8.

The prologue demo, titled Wonhon Beginning, includes the first four levels of the final release. It will showcase what players can expect in terms of stealth and tactics, as well as tease parts of the plot. Set in Korea during the 1920s, the player takes control of a wonhon, or human spirit consumed by grief. A jeoseung Saja (저승사자), literally translating to “The Other World Messenger,” is, while not a perfect match, somewhat analogous to the Grim Reaper in Western mythology. Death appears in folklore, either directly or symbolically, in just about every culture in the world. Jeoseung Saja specifically feature in many Korean myths involving death, whether it be through cheating it or accepting its inevitability.

You’ll have to balance using stealth versus an aggressive all-out war in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it.

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it features a top-down perspective. The protagonist takes Qi from living creatures, allowing her to temporarily possess their bodies. Wonhon is published by Super.com, an international video game publisher. Busan Sanai Games, a Korean indie studio, developed Wonhon: A Vengeful Spirit. Developer Seungwhan Shin’s other work includes Maruta Escape for iOS and Android devices and released in 2018.
